Course Description:
Millions of Americans toss and turn each night longing for a rejuvenating evening. Distressed sleep is often seen across a variety of age groups, cultures, and demographic populations. The good thing is that there is hope for restful sleep.
Disappointingly, answers to insomnia are not found within the purchase of a new mattress, the sounds of waterfalls or aromatherapy. Fortunately, cognitive behavioral therapies have proven to be effective in helping many individuals improve their sleep quality, often without requiring medication.
Webinar participants will learn how to keenly listen to their clients’ sleep struggles and help them develop effective sleep interventions. Important topics such as medical conditions, biological factors, stimulus control and sleep restriction will be discussed in great detail to develop treatment interventions.
The webinar will provide mental health professionals best practices to assess and treat insomnia. Participants will learn how to apply treatment specific approaches to help clients achieve better sleep. The training will use a case vignette to guide effective treatment and to expose and resolve common treatment.
Participants will leave the webinar with a clear understanding of factors that influence sleep problems, as well as powerful strategies to help their clients feel rested and rejuvenated.
Learning Objectives:
Upon the completion of this course, participants will be able to:
- Describe diagnostic criteria for insomnia, sleep related disorders, and related mood disorders
- Understand the anatomy of sleep (sleep drive and circadian clock) to guide treatment interventions
- Recall 4 salient factors specific to CBT for Insomnia and effective sleep hygiene strategies for short and long-term sleep solutions.
